The Chaves County Detention Center is the adult local booking point for many county, city, and state local arrests in Roswell and the surrounding county. It holds adult pretrial detainees, county-sentenced inmates, and people waiting on release, transfer, or other agency action. The Chaves County Sheriff's Office, led by Sheriff Mike Herrington, is a separate county department with its own law-enforcement records role. For a current custody question, call the detention center first. For a sheriff report or agency routing question, the Sheriff's Office may be the better starting point.
A Chaves County jail roster search does not cover every person with a Chaves County connection. Sentenced New Mexico state prisoners are searched through the New Mexico Corrections Department, including people at Roswell Correctional Center in Hagerman. Federal prisoners use the Bureau of Prisons locator after BOP designation, and immigration custody uses ICE ODLS. VINELink is useful for notifications, but it is not a full booking file.

New Mexico law supports why some fields exist even when they are not posted online. NMSA 29-3-8 concerns biometric identifying information collected after certain arrests, and legislative materials describe that information as including photographs, fingerprints, and palm prints. N.M. Admin. Code 1.21.2.902 describes jail inmate files as correctional institution public safety records retained for five years from the date the file closes.
Chaves County Custody Compared
Chaves County inmate records can sit in several systems at once. A person may be booked into the county jail, have charges filed in New Mexico Courts, later transfer to NMCD after sentencing, or be held for a federal or immigration agency. The fastest way to avoid bad results is to match the question to the custody stage.
| Custody Type | Where to Look | What It Covers |
|---|---|---|
| County jail | Chaves County Detention Center, 575-624-6517 | Current local adult custody, booking status, release routing, and jail-held records. |
| State prison or supervision | New Mexico Corrections Department Offender Search | NMCD prison, probation, and parole records; not county or city detention. |
| Federal prison | BOP Inmate Locator | Federal inmates, mainly 1982-present, with daily updates and federal-only scope. |
| Federal pretrial | U.S. Marshals District of New Mexico | Federal arrest-to-trial custody context; many prisoners are housed in local or contract facilities. |
| Immigration detention | ICE Online Detainee Locator System | A-number or biographical search for ICE detainees, separate from county jail records. |
The federal path is different from Chaves County jail custody. The BOP locator returns fields such as name, register number, age, race, sex, release date, and location. BOP says its records are federal, mainly for people held since 1982, and updated daily.
The official BOP locator landing page is helpful when a Chaves County arrest is unrelated to the current custody because the person has entered federal prison.
If the person is still in local adult custody, the BOP result will not replace a call to Chaves County Detention.

Chaves County Booking Records
Local booking begins after arrest by an agency such as the Chaves County Sheriff's Office, Roswell Police Department, New Mexico State Police, a municipal agency, or a federal agency acting in a local case. For local adult custody, the person is transported to the Chaves County Detention Center. Intake may include identity confirmation, property inventory, search, medical or mental-health screening, a booking photograph, fingerprints, palm prints, charge entry, warrant checks, hold checks, and classification.
Classification means the jail's assessment for custody level and housing. It is not a court outcome. A detainer is a hold or request from another agency, such as a different county, parole office, federal authority, or ICE. A person can have bond on one charge and still remain in custody because of another hold.

Chaves County Visitation Rules
Adult detention visitation is one of the clearest official Chaves County jail topics. The county's adult detention visitation page lists visit days, public-entry rules, visitor limits, ID requirements, and banned property. Those rules are separate from NMCD prison visitation at Roswell Correctional Center.
| Facility | Days | Times | Limits |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chaves County Adult Detention Center | Thursday, Friday, Sunday | 8:30-11:00 a.m.; 1:00-3:00 p.m. | Two visits per week; up to two adults and three children. |
| Roswell Correctional Center | Saturday-Tuesday | Four two-hour blocks from 8:15 a.m.-5:00 p.m. | Visitor must be on the NMCD approved list. |
For Chaves County adult detention, visitors age 18 or older must have picture ID and be on the inmate's visitation list. Visitors must sign up in the lobby before visiting. Cell phones, purses, backpacks, photographs, and tape recordings are not allowed. All visitors are subject to search while on the premises, and rule violations can affect both the visitor and the inmate.
